Ribera del Marlin, Spain


Nature of Project:  Residential
Location: Marina de Sotogrande, parcela 5-6/P.2. Sotogrande. San Roque (CÁDIZ)
Developer: Residencial Marlín, S.L., Grupo Sotogrande.


When developer B Solis Constructora decided to build a residential estate on the golfing heaven of Sotogrande in Cadiz, they needed to create something in keeping with the expectations of the affluent clientele that frequented the area.  Their property therefore had to be not just functional but luxurious in detail.  Bathrooms were a good starting point but with 444 of them, clearly they needed affordability too.  Designer furnishings were de rigor, but with space being typically a premium in bathrooms, they considered foregoing heating so he could omit radiators.
 

The Solution
Warmup suggested underfloor heating - stylish without compromising on function.  In fact, it would significantly enhance the living conditions of the homeowner.  Laid under the expanse of the floor, not only is there no need for design-restricting, space-chomping radiators, the heat emitted is far more even and comfortable than with conventional radiators.  It also improves hygiene levels by reducing drafts and airborne allergens.  Warmup electric underfloor heating systems are operated by separate thermostats in individual rooms, which offers more control over the heating, increasing energy efficiency and allowing cost savings of up to 15% as compared to traditional electric radiators.  These advantages are made all the more attractive by how maintenance free the system is.

The Experience

For B Solis, the process was a breeze right from the start.  Based on their requirements, Warmup worked out the heaters needed, along with a quote that included subfloor insulations and everything else that was needed for the set up of the system, so that there were no nasty surprises for the overall cost.  As part of the full service, Warmup’s skilled technicians even fitted the system so that the developer could be assured of the utmost professionalism in its installation.  Insulation boards were laid down to prevent unnecessary heat loss through the subfloors, followed by Warmup® mats which were rolled out quickly around fixtures before being wired to MSTAT manual thermostats that run off the mains.  Because the systems can be laid straight onto existing subfloors and tiled directly over in a matter of hours, it adds minimal time to the construction of the project as a whole, so the project is still well on schedule for completion before summer 2008.
